The Exhaust Gas Recirculation (EGR) system is crucial for reducing harmful emissions in diesel engines. By recirculating a portion of the exhaust back into the combustion chamber, EGR technology helps to lower combustion temperatures and reduce nitrogen oxide (NOx) emissions, making it an essential component for environmentally friendly diesel performance.
Modern EGR systems are designed to enhance vehicle efficiency while maintaining compliance with emission regulations. For instance, advanced EGR coolers and valves ensure optimal performance, allowing diesel vehicles to not only meet stringent environmental standards but also improve fuel economy. Understanding how EGR works can help vehicle owners make informed decisions about their diesel tuning and performance upgrades.

Maintenance Tips for EGR Systems
Regular maintenance of your EGR system is vital for sustaining optimal engine performance and longevity. This includes routine inspections, cleaning of EGR valves, and monitoring for any signs of wear or clogging. Neglecting EGR maintenance can lead to reduced engine efficiency and increased emissions, ultimately affecting vehicle performance.
For instance, a simple cleaning of the EGR valve can prevent potential issues such as rough idling or decreased acceleration. Additionally, keeping an eye on the EGR cooler for any leaks or blockages can help ensure that your diesel engine operates smoothly. Implementing these maintenance practices can save you from costly repairs and extend the life of your vehicle.
